What’s the Difference Between Brilinta 90mg (Ticagrelor) and Plavix (Clopidogrel)?

When it comes to treating blood clots, there are two popular tablets in the medical world: Brilinta (Ticagrelor) and Plavix (Clopidogrel).

Both these medications are used to thin blood, also called blood thinners. Doctors generally prescribe these meds to prevent blood clotting and reduce the risk of heart-related events like heart attack or stroke.

Such medicines are called antiplatelet drugs, which block P2Y12 receptors in your body. This receptor sticks together to form clots with the help of small blood cells called platelets. The Brilinta and Plavix medicines prevent blood clots by blocking the P2Y12 receptors.

Uses of Plavix and Brilinta

Both these medicines are prescribed by doctors to prevent and reduce problems related to the heart and blood vessels, like heart attack or stroke, in people with:

  • History of heart attacks (myocardial infarctions) or strokes
  • Recent percutaneous coronary intervention (PCI), also known as angioplasty (a nonsurgical procedure that opens up blocked heart vessels with a thin tube)

These medicines act in the same manner by blocking the P2Y12 receptor to keep platelets from forming blood clots. The doctors may also prescribe a low dose of aspirin to further reduce the risk of blood clotting.
